WebOct 30, 2024 · The most common ways to use the shutdown command are: shutdown -s — Shuts down. shutdown -r — Restarts. shutdown -l — Logs off. shutdown -h — Hibernates. Note: There is a common pitfall wherein users think -h means "help" (which it does for every other command-line program... except shutdown.exe, where it means "hibernate"). WebMay 19, 2024 · After the Run dialog box appears, enter the following command: shutdown -s -t 3600. Inside: shutdown : Turn off the computer. s : shorthand for shutdown. t : stands for time. 3600 : The shutdown timer time is in seconds (3600 seconds = 1 hour). WebDec 5, 2024 · Right-click the Windows 11 desktop and select the New context menu option. Select Shortcut to open the Create Shortcut window. Now input shutdown /s /t 0 within the location text box as in the screenshot directly below. Click the Next button to proceed to the naming step. Type Shutdown within the text box. Remotely Shutdown a Windows 10 Computer. … WebFortunately, it is relatively easy to create a cancel shutdown shortcut. Here’s how. Go to the desktop. Right-click on the desktop. Choose “ New > Shortcut .”. Type “ shutdown.exe -a ” in the Location field. Press “ Next .”. Type “ Abort shutdown ” in the name field. Press “ Finish .”.

C:\> shutdown /a should stop the currently pending shutdown; unless it has already begun, in which case it will alert you that it can't. From the shutdown.exe help: /a - Abort a system shutdown.
